About Network & Structured Wiring in Las Cruces
Network and structured wiring covers Ethernet cable runs, patch panel installation, Wi-Fi access point placement, and home office networking. Hardwired connections deliver faster, more reliable internet than Wi-Fi alone — especially important for remote work and streaming.
Typical costs: Running a single Ethernet drop costs $150–$400. A full-home structured wiring package with patch panel and multiple drops runs $1,500–$5,000. Business network setups start at $2,000+.
- Ethernet cable runs to rooms
- Patch panel and network rack setup
- Wi-Fi access point installation
- Home office network setup
- Structured wiring for new construction
Low-voltage wiring like Ethernet doesn't require permits in most areas. Some jurisdictions require low-voltage contractor licensing.
Frequently Asked Questions
- How much does network & structured wiring cost in Las Cruces?
- Individual Ethernet runs cost $150–$400 depending on distance and difficulty of the route. A whole-home package with 6–8 drops, patch panel, and a network switch runs $1,500–$4,000. Adding mesh Wi-Fi access points with hardwired backhaul adds $500–$1,500.
- How do I find a reliable network & structured wiring contractor in Las Cruces?
- Choose an installer who uses Cat6 or Cat6a cable (not Cat5e, which is outdated for modern speeds). They should terminate cables properly and test each run. Ask whether they include a patch panel or just leave loose cables.
- Do I need a permit for network & structured wiring in Las Cruces?
- Ethernet and low-voltage wiring installations generally don't require permits. However, if the installer needs to drill through fire-rated walls or run cable through conduit, local codes may apply.
